01 · Measured

Matcha should be measured, not guessed.

Most counters treat matcha as one undifferentiated green powder. We treat it the way a lab treats two different reagents — distinct grades, distinct purposes, never substituted to protect a margin.

02 · Slow

Slow is a feature, not a delay.

Every bowl is whisked to order with a bamboo chasen. No batching, no pre-mixing. The few minutes it takes to prepare a proper bowl are part of the product — not friction to be engineered away.

03 · Honest

Pricing should be honest.

If a grade is expensive to source, it's priced like it's expensive to source. Uji specialty stays full-price always — including under every pass and the founding membership — because discounting it would mean either losing money or quietly downgrading the cup.
